PCB Electro-Mechanical Designer
The PCB Electro-Mechanical Designer is part of a team for product development of linear and switch-mode power supplies and has an integral role in creating high-density, mixed-technology printed circuit boards (PCBs) and their associated mechanical components.
Essential Duties and Responsibilities
Collaborate with electrical engineers, mechanical design, and manufacturing teams to ensure designs meet specifications using Design for Excellence principles
Verify PWB design through virtual modeling using CAD tools (AutoCAD, SolidWorks)
Participate in design reviews, implement design changes and resolve any issues during prototyping and production stages.
Contribute to the mechanical design and packaging (3D model) of linear and switch-mode power supplies (10W-30kW, 3V-10KV) used to power magnets, redundant processes, in applications requiring bidirectional and four quadrants, in analytical instrumentation, industrial test equipment, security and OEM power assemblies and supplies.
Adhere to standard PCB manufacturing processes to ensure quality, compliance, and reliability. Knowledge of IPC and UL standards, EMI/EMC as well as design provisions for automatic testing.
Generate Gerber files, assembly files and BOMs. Create detailed manufacturing instructions via 2D/3D CAD drawings or MS Office.
Stay current with the latest PCB design trends and technologies through continuous learning, supporting both personal career growth and team capabilities.
Qualifications
Experience designing PCBs with CAD tools such as Altium, KiCAD, ORCAD or equivalent.
Experience in creating schematics and block diagrams using CAD/CAE
Knowledge of electronic circuit layout and electronic packaging principles.
Proficiency in PCB-related mechanical design and 3D packaging using AutoCAD, Inventor 3D, SolidWorks or similar CAD tools.
Ability to select the proper substrate, rigid, flexible, Cu weight, thru or blind vias and isolation techniques for analog and digital PWB design
Strong understanding of PCB assemblies’ fabrication processes and technologies
Knowledge of BOM and ERP systems.
Work with minimal supervision, able to multitask, excellent communication skills and ability to work in a team environment and productive with Office
Hands on abilities to assemble bread boards
Preferred Qualifications
Associate’s degree in Engineering.
7+ years of relevant experience.
Experience in the switching power supply industry a plus
Background in general mechanical packaging design and 3D modeling.
Strong knowledge of electromechanical components, mechanical housing fabrication (sheet metal) and plastic molding a definite plus.
